Toulouse (France) took the third prize. Toulouse is committed to improving the life of its disabled citizens, be it in the field of transport where the metro, trams and buses are 100% accessible or in the cultural sector where operas are performed with audio-description and programmes are available in large print or braille. The José-Cabanis multimedia library has facilities for the visually-impaired as well as a collection of 1,600 braille books and newspapers. Toulouse is a member of the “Friendly Cities for the Elderly” group and since 2012 has taken part in the international network “Design for All”. Video script (pdf - 180 KB)
